Precision Air Tanzania

I was wondering if anyone could give me some information about Precision Air in Tanzania. I applied for the position of FO (ATR) and got invited for an interview. I'm typerated ATR 42/72 with around 500 hrs on type, 1100 total. Can anyone give some info about how many hrs a month they're flying there, the roster, living costs in Dar and income tax in Tanzania. And any other info you may think is relevant.

Housing is high in Dar compared to the rest of Tanzania, though you could ask to be based out of Arusha. You will loose around 40% of your income in taxes and pension plan. It takes a while to get checked out till you are you only earn 70% of your salary after tax. Hours initially are low around 75 a month after that they can get pretty high, easily 1000 a year. Roster changes are frequent. But if your dual rated less likely to affect you. Crew are not a bad bunch, flying can be interesting since we also fly to rough strips. We need the pilots since we just got two of our 72's back online and next year we get two new 42's and one 72. Though one or two of our current 72's are due to go back to the lesor.

Interview is pretty straight forward, nothing big. Same for the sim check just your usual base check kind of stuff. As for command your hours are too low. Think you need 2500-3000 for command. Plenty of guys waiting their turn to get the left seat.
